提出了一种适合于非晶合金铸坯连续生产的复合铸型连续铸造法并据此建立了一套水平连铸装置。采用拉停循环的间歇式拉坯方式成功连铸出直径10mm长度60cm的Zr基非晶合金棒材。金相、XRD、DSC等分析结果表明该方法制备的非晶合金有很好的非晶性。还基于非晶合金形成的CCT曲线,探讨了复合铸型连续铸造法形成非晶合金的冷却过程。该方法可用于非晶合金棒材工业化生产,并能降低生产成本,促进非晶合金研究的发展和应用。
A continuous casting method suitable for the continuous production of amorphous alloy billet was proposed and a set of horizontal continuous casting equipment was established. The continuous casting method was used to successfully cast Zr-based amorphous alloy rods with diameter of 10mm and length of 60cm. The results of metallography, XRD, DSC and so on show that the amorphous alloy prepared by the method has good non-crystallinity. Based on the CCT curve of amorphous alloy, the cooling process of amorphous alloy by continuous casting process was discussed. The method can be used for the industrial production of amorphous alloy bar, and can reduce the production cost and promote the development and application of the research of the amorphous alloy.
